Applying to A*AA with AAA for accounting and finance

Is this not wise to apply for kings who want A*AA predicted for accounting and finance when I have predicted AAA. Or would I have a better shot at applying to Warwick who also want predicted A*AA. I really want to get into one of these unis.

Statistically speaking, the offer rate at Warwick according to UCAS (55%) would be higher than the offer rate at KCL (35%), which would mean that in theory it is easier to obtain an offer from Warwick than KCL for accounting and finance. However, in practice, being one grade off the entry requirements might result in an aspirational offer with higher grade requirements than your predicted grades being made (i.e. A*AA) if the university feels that you have been able to show through other aspects of your application that you are a suitable candidate for their course. Ultimately, you’re a grade below the entry requirements for each of these universities, but you can afford to be aspirational with at least one (if not more) of your choices, so long as you are being realistic with your safety choices. In this case, I would advise that you apply to the university you prefer rather than trying to estimate your chances and make a decision based off of this.
